![]() ![]() Its key design goal was readability, that the language be readable as-is, without looking like it has been marked up with tags or formatting instructions, unlike text formatted with 'heavier' markup languages, such as Rich Text Format (RTF), HTML, or even wikitext (each of which have obvious in-line tags and formatting instructions which can make the text more difficult for humans to read). Gruber created the Markdown language in 2004, with Schwartz acting as beta tester, had the goal of enabling people "to write using an easy-to-read and easy-to-write plain text format, optionally convert it to structurally valid XHTML (or HTML)." In 2002 Aaron Swartz created atx and referred to it as "the true structured text format". Markdown was inspired by pre-existing conventions for marking up plain text in email and usenet posts, such as the earlier markup languages setext (c. This was addressed in 2014, when long-standing Markdown contributors released CommonMark, an unambiguous specification and test suite for Markdown. The initial description of Markdown contained ambiguities and raised unanswered questions, causing implementations to both intentionally and accidentally diverge from the original version. Markdown is widely used in blogging, instant messaging, online forums, collaborative software, documentation pages, and readme files. John Gruber created Markdown in 2004 as a markup language that is appealing to human readers in its source code form. Markdown is a lightweight markup language for creating formatted text using a plain-text editor. And we don’t recommend to put too much stuff in YAML front matter.Pandoc, MultiMarkdown, Markdown Extra, CommonMark, RMarkdown ĭaringfireball. Typora parses YAML front matter in very “flexible” or “fault-tolerant” way, to avoid large content change during YAML editing.Usually, keys in YAML are case-sensitive.Only whitespace is supported for indentation, tab is not supported, and indentation is very important in YAML.(Not supported in HTML (without style))ĭata that will be inserted into tag, after HTML export, see detail.ĭata that will be inserted into tag, in addition of the global append-head setting, after HTML / PDF export, see detail.ĭata that will be inserted into tag, in addition of the global append-body setting, after HTML / PDF export, see detail.įor pandoc export formats, some other settings will be parse from yaml meta data, like header-includes:, see pandoc manual for details. Whether to include sidebar or not in exported HTML. Since the markdown file may be created by others, for security reasons, native supported formats (PDF / HTML) require “Read and overwrite export settings from YAML front matter” to be enabled in export preferences panel, then settings in YAML front matter can be used and overwrite global export settings. The base path for image resources, see detail.Īctions when user insert or drag & drop images into Typora, see detail. Use in per-document configuration Images key For example, Jekyll uses YAML Front Matter this way. More commonly, YAML front matter will be in 3rd party tools, like static website generators or blog systems based on markdown files. You could find more in Using as Variables / Settings on 3rd Party Tools You can add custom contents in Append in and Append in, which will be inserted into part and part in the exported html. And author will be added as meta data when exported to PDF or pub format. For example, when exporting markdown file above into HTML format, typora will output YAML Front Matter into HTML Element.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Lorem ipsum dolor sit amet, consectetur adipiscing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. title : YAML Front Matter category : how-to author : typora.io tags : typora-root-url.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|